Gasoline: The Time-Honored Fuel: For over a century, gasoline has dominated as the primary fuel for automobiles. Derived from crude oil, gasoline consists of a hydrocarbon blend. It boasts a high energy density, facilitating impressive power output in internal combustion engines. With widespread availability, gasoline proves convenient for most drivers. However, the combustion of gasoline emits greenhouse gases and pollutants that contribute to air pollution and climate change. Diesel: The Efficient Workhorse: Diesel fuel finds application primarily in heavy-duty vehicles and commercial settings. Renowned for its efficiency and torque, diesel engines excel in hauling heavy loads and long-distance driving. Diesel fuel offers higher energy content per unit volume compared to gasoline, translating to enhanced fuel efficiency. Nevertheless, diesel combustion releases higher levels of nitrogen oxides (NOx) and particulate matter, posing risks to human health and the environment. Ethanol: A Renewable Option: Ethanol, an alcohol-based fuel derived from renewable sources such as corn or sugarcane, presents a viable alternative. It can be used as a standalone fuel or blended with gasoline in various ratios (e.g., E10 or E85). Ethanol reduces the carbon footprint of vehicles as it stems from renewable resources. It also boasts a higher octane rating, thereby enhancing engine performance. However, ethanol possesses lower energy content than gasoline, leading to slightly reduced fuel efficiency. Biodiesel: A Cleaner Alternative: Biodiesel, sourced from vegetable oils or animal fats, stands as a renewable fuel option. It can be employed as a pure fuel or blended with diesel. Biodiesel substantially diminishes greenhouse gas emissions compared to conventional diesel fuel due to its renewable origins. Additionally, it exhibits superior lubricating properties that can extend the lifespan of diesel engines. Nevertheless, biodiesel may result in higher nitrogen oxide emissions, and its availability may be restricted in certain regions. Compressed Natural Gas (CNG): The Environmentally Friendly Choice: Compressed Natural Gas (CNG), primarily composed of methane, is a gaseous fuel stored at high pressure. It serves as a cleaner alternative to gasoline or diesel. CNG combustion yields significantly lower emissions, including greenhouse gases, particulate matter, and nitrogen oxides. CNG-powered vehicles deliver performance characteristics comparable to gasoline vehicles, albeit with a slightly reduced driving range due to the requirement for larger fuel storage systems.
